Where's the healthiest place to live in the United States?

Los Alamos County, New Mexico, is the healthiest community in the United States, according to U.S. News & World Report's 2021 Healthiest Communities Rankings, which ranks counties and county equivalents on 10 health-related criteria.

What is the healthiest state to live in in the United States?

1. Vermont. Vermont is considered the healthiest state in the U.S. Vermont's adult obesity rate is 26.6%, the seventh-lowest in the country, and its adult smoking rate is 15.1%, the 21st-lowest. Physical activity is common in Vermont, with just about 80% of residents reporting daily exercise, the seventh-highest.

Which state eats most healthy food?

constructed an index based on five behavioral factors, including vegetable, fruit, and soda consumption by adults and high school students. California leads the nation with the healthiest eating habits, while Mississippi residents have the nation's worst diets.

Where is the healthiest place to retire?

The healthiest community to retire in the United States is none other than San Juan County, Washington. The 65-and-over population increased by 1.9% due to seniors moving to the county from out of state, among the most of any county. San Juan is also one of the healthiest counties nationwide.

Which state is the least healthiest?

Meanwhile, we found that Mississippi, Louisiana and Arkansas are the three least healthy states in America for 2020. All three states are the least healthy in America given a high prevalence of children in poverty and high cardiovascular death rates.

Why are people in Colorado so healthy?

Colorado adults take good care of themselves, beyond just keeping their weight down. They rank well in terms of physical activity and healthy diets. Smoking rates among adults have dropped, and Colorado adults rank second in the nation for low blood pressure and low rates of diabetes.
